An Advanced Skill Certificate in Genetic Diversity in Crops equips participants with in-depth knowledge and practical skills in assessing, managing, and utilizing genetic resources for crop improvement. The program emphasizes modern techniques in plant breeding, molecular biology, and bioinformatics.
Learning outcomes include a comprehensive understanding of genetic diversity analysis, application of molecular markers (SSR, SNP), population genetics principles in crop improvement, and the conservation of genetic resources in plants. Participants will gain hands-on experience with various laboratory and computational techniques relevant to genetic diversity studies.
